Bengaluru: The Archdiocese of Bangalore on Friday announced that it will hold a Peace Assembly against the Karnataka Government’s move to introduce Anti-Conversion Bill in the state assembly. The assembly will be held at the St. Francis Xavier Cathedral Grounds, Fraser Town in Bengaluru on Saturday, 4 December.
